Hong Kong is part of China, but shipping to Hong Kong from mainland China is considered as cross border shipping which is more complex than domestic shipping inside mainland China?
Customs Requirements: Although Hong Kong is part of China, it operates under a different customs territory due to its status as a Special Administrative Region (SAR) with its own legal and economic systems. As a result, goods shipped from mainland China to Hong Kong must go through customs clearance, just like any other international shipment.
Documentation: Shipping to Hong Kong requires extra documentation, such as a commercial invoice, packing list, and possibly import/export declarations, depending on the nature of the goods.
How long does it take to ship to Hong Kong?
Shipping from mainland China to Hong Kong takes 1-5 days, depending on where your item is located. For example, if your item is in Beijing or Shanghai, it typically takes 2 days to transport it to Shenzhen. After all inspections and documentation are completed, a cross-border truck will drive from Shenzhen to Hong Kong, where it will arrive at a Hong Kong warehouse for dispatch.
Why shipping to HongKong is more expensive?
- It is considered ‘international shipping,’ or at least cross-border shipping.
- The general cost in HongKong is quite high compared to mainland China;
- In Hong Kong, unlike in mainland China where service fees are generally not itemized in detail, service charges are applied to various aspects, such as tunnel tolls, parking fees, stair-climbing fees, etc.

Can I send it back to mainland China from Hong Kong?
Technically, yes. But sending items back to mainland China from Hong Kong is considered an import, so it involves many documents and procedures.
What Shipping Options Are Available for Sending from Mainland China to Hong Kong?
- Express Service: Services like UPS, DHL, FedEx, and SF Express are great for documents and small parcels. These services are fast but can be quite expensive.
- Land Transport: If you’re not in a hurry, land transport is the best choice. It’s also a door-to-door service, making it ideal for larger packages, furniture, or home appliances.
